Mun Tahu Recipe
Ingredients:
- 2 blocks of white tofu, cut into small cubes
- 200 grams of beef, finely sliced
- 4 cloves of garlic, crushed and chopped
- 1/2 onion, chopped into small pieces
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ch, mixed with a little water
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on fish sauce
- 150 ml water (add more if necessary)
- 1 tablespoon cooking oil
- 1 teaspoon sesame oil
- Scallions, thinly sliced, to taste
- Sugar, salt, and pepper, to taste
Steps:
- Cut the tofu into small cubes.
- Heat the cooking oil in a pan, then sauté the garlic and onion until fragrant.
- Add the beef slices and cook until done.
- Add the tofu and water, stirring gently.
- Pour in the soy sauce, fish sauce, and season with sugar, salt, and pepper according to your taste.
- Stir in the cornstarch mixture, cooking until the sauce thickens and starts to bubble.
- Add the scallions and sesame oil, mixing well.
- Serve the Mun Tahu while still warm.
Enjoy this delightful Mun Tahu as a comforting meal that brings together the rich flavors of tofu and beef, enhanced by aromatic garlic, savory soy and fish sauces, and a hint of sesame. This dish is perfect for a cozy dinner, offering both nutrition and a burst of umami in every bite.
